Outdoor recreation conflict on trails in Squamish, British Columbia : an examination of theoretical models and management.
Understanding the social interactions of trail users is a challenge for recreation managers globally. Recreationists are not homogenous and differences in their expectations, behaviours and values may create conflict and consequently, recreationists´ levels of satisfaction may be decreased. On the...
